Ryszard Kapuściński

“From a logical point of view, anyone
who sets out to create a Great Civilization ought to begin with people, with training cadres of experts
in order to form a native intelligentsia. But it was precisely that kind of thinking that was unacceptable. Open new universities and polytechnics, every one a hornets' nest, every student a rebel, a good-for-nothing, a freethinker?”

Ryszard Kapuściński, Shah of Shahs
